Erdheim Chester Disease in Netherlands Trends and Forecast
The future of the erdheim chester disease market in Netherlands looks promising with opportunities in the hospital, homecare, and specialty clinic markets. The global erdheim chester disease market is expected to grow with a CAGR of 8.1% from 2025 to 2031. The erdheim chester disease market in Netherlands is also forecasted to witness strong growth over the forecast period. The major drivers for this market are an increase in the number of drugs for erdheim chester disease, growing awareness and early diagnosis of ECD, along with the rising healthcare expenditure worldwide.
• Lucintel forecasts that, within the treatment type category, surgery is expected to witness the highest growth over the forecast period.
• Within the end use category, hospitals will remain the largest segment.

• Increased adoption of targeted therapies: The Netherlands is witnessing a surge in the use of targeted therapies, such as BRAF and MEK inhibitors, for ECD patients. These treatments are tailored to specific genetic mutations, leading to improved efficacy and fewer side effects compared to traditional therapies. This trend is transforming the standard of care, offering patients more effective and personalized treatment options, and is expected to drive market growth as more targeted agents become available.
• Enhanced diagnostic capabilities: Advances in imaging technologies and molecular diagnostics are enabling earlier and more accurate detection of ECD in the Netherlands. Improved diagnostic tools, such as PET-CT scans and next-generation sequencing, are helping clinicians identify disease manifestations and underlying mutations. This trend is reducing diagnostic delays, allowing for timely intervention and better disease management, ultimately improving patient outcomes and supporting market expansion.

The challenges in the Erdheim Chester Disease Market in Netherlands are:
• High Cost of Treatment: The therapies used to manage Erdheim Chester Disease, particularly targeted treatments and biologics, are often associated with substantial costs. These high expenses can limit patient access, especially in cases where reimbursement policies are restrictive or out-of-pocket costs are significant. The financial burden on healthcare systems and patients may hinder the widespread adoption of innovative therapies, posing a significant challenge to market growth and equitable access to care.
• Limited Patient Population: Erdheim Chester Disease is an ultra-rare condition, resulting in a small patient pool within the Netherlands. This limited population poses challenges for conducting large-scale clinical trials, attracting pharmaceutical investment, and justifying the allocation of resources for research and development. The rarity of the disease also makes it difficult to establish standardized treatment protocols and gather robust real-world evidence, which can slow the pace of innovation and market expansion.
• Complex Regulatory Pathways: The approval and commercialization of therapies for rare diseases like Erdheim Chester Disease often involve navigating complex regulatory requirements. These processes can be time-consuming and resource-intensive, particularly for novel or orphan drugs. Regulatory uncertainty, coupled with the need for post-marketing surveillance and long-term safety data, can delay the introduction of new treatments and increase development costs, thereby challenging the growth of the market in the Netherlands.
